Question - En Ramli retired optionally from government service on 28 February 2019, his 58 years birthday. He commenced employment with Tanjong Sdn Bhd on 1 April 2019 at a monthly salary of RM9,000. The following information applied to En Ramli and Pn Yati, his wife.

En Ramli The company provided him with a new company car costing RM120,000 and a driver. The car was delivered to him on 1 July 2019.

On 1 July 2019, he moved to a fully furnished house provided by the company. The annual value of the house was RM25,000. The value of the furnishings was RM280 per month as per IRB guidelines.

Other benefits provided by the company for the period 1 April to 31 December 2019 were as follows:

RM

Medical treatment for his children 1,500

Dental treatment for his wife 200

Two leave passage to Tasik Kenyir 2,800

One leave passage to Melaka 1,200

His income from government service for the year ended 31 December 2019 was as follows:

RM

Salary (January - February) 12,000

Pension (March - December) 20,000

Retirement gratuity 75,000

En Ramli's contributions to the EPF in 2019 were RM8,910. In January 2019 his son was warded in a private hospital for serious illness while vacationing in Kuching. He incurred personal medical expenses of RM4,100.

He donate a hamper of goods worth RM300 to an old folks home, an approved institution. He claim child relief in respect of an adopt child, age 12 whom he adopted on 5 October 2019 in accordance with the law.

Pn Yati

Her income for the year ended 31 December 2019 was as follows:

Dividend received on 30 June 2019 RM10,000

Rental income (nett) 8,000

Pn Yati has a son from her previous marriage. The son, age 20 and unmarried commenced his university education in Australia in November 2018. Pn Yati incurred RM6,000 for his education. She also has a daughter from her previous marriage who is aged 15 and unmarried. Pn Yati claimed child relief for her son but not for her daughter. She, however, claimed relief for insurance premium RM2,200 in respect of education for her daughter.

A donation of RM400 was made to the Cancer Foundation, an approved institution.

Required - Compute the tax payable by En Ramli and Pn Yati for the year of assessment 2019. Pn Yati did not elect for combined assessment.
